Diving into Customer Reviews: What's the Word on the Street?
Alright, let's get real. The best way to gauge a store's legitimacy is by checking out what other customers are saying. Customer reviews are like gold dust when it comes to online shopping. They give you a real, unfiltered perspective on the shopping experience. So, how do we find these reviews, and what should we be looking for? The first place to check is the IIS Champions Sports Store website itself. However, keep in mind that these reviews could be curated, so take them with a grain of salt. Next, head over to independent review sites like Trustpilot, Sitejabber, or the Better Business Bureau (BBB). These platforms provide a more unbiased view. Look for a mix of positive and negative reviews. No store is perfect, and a few negative reviews are normal. But a large number of complaints about the same issues should raise a red flag. What exactly are people complaining about? Common issues to watch out for include delayed shipping, poor customer service, incorrect products, or damaged items. If you see a pattern of these complaints, it's a sign that something might be wrong.
Also, pay close attention to the details of the reviews. Are they specific and detailed, or are they vague and generic? Detailed reviews, which describe the specific issues the customer faced, are more trustworthy than generic ones. Read reviews from different dates to see if the store has addressed any previous issues. Has the customer service improved? Have they started shipping more quickly? A good company will learn from its mistakes and improve its service over time.
Look for responses from the company to the negative reviews. A legitimate company will try to address customer complaints and offer solutions. They may apologize for the issue and offer a refund, a replacement, or other forms of compensation. This shows that they care about their customers and are willing to take responsibility for their mistakes. Consider the overall sentiment of the reviews. Is the majority of the feedback positive or negative? A store with mostly positive reviews is generally a safer bet than one with mostly negative reviews. However, don't let a few negative reviews scare you off completely. Every company makes mistakes from time to time. Navigating the Purchasing Process: Red Flags and Green Lights
Okay, let's say you've browsed the website, checked out the reviews, and are ready to make a purchase. Now what? The purchasing process itself can reveal a lot about a store's legitimacy. Firstly, let's talk about the website security. Before you enter any personal or financial information, make sure the website is secure. Look for the padlock icon in the address bar, which indicates that the connection is encrypted and your information is protected. Also, look for "https" at the beginning of the website address. The "s" stands for "secure". Any website that asks for your credit card information must have these security measures in place.
What about payment options? Does the store offer secure payment options, like credit card processing or PayPal? These options provide an extra layer of protection for your purchase. If the store only accepts obscure payment methods, or asks you to wire money directly to an individual, that should be a huge red flag. Check the return policy before you buy anything. Does the store offer a clear and easy-to-understand return policy? What is the timeframe for returns? Are there any restocking fees? A legitimate store will typically have a fair return policy that allows you to return items if you're not satisfied. Also, what are the shipping costs and estimated delivery times? Be sure to check the shipping costs before you finalize your order. Are they reasonable? Are there any hidden fees? Also, take a look at the estimated delivery times. If they seem unrealistic, or if the store doesn't provide any information about shipping at all, that's a warning sign.
